What is the difference between CO2 and H2O? Are they a bond polarity or a overall polarity?
Lewis Dot Structure, which element has more electronegativity? Which one is a bond and which one is a overall polairty? Compare them.
Bond best answer:
Answer by Buddha
Both the C-O bonds and H-O bonds are polar, but the H2O has overall polarity while the CO2 molecule does not.
Oxygen has the greatest electronegativity.
